Pokesdown Train Station offers a range of essential facilities to accommodate travelers. The ticket office is operational from the early hours of 05:50 on weekdays, although services taper off in the afternoon. Saturday hours are slightly reduced, and the office remains closed on Sundays. There are ticket machines available for collecting tickets ordered online, and these machines are accessible to passengers with the Disabled Persons Railcard as well.
Despite the absence of step-free access, Pokesdown Station provides other forms of accessibility support, including induction loops and ramps for train access. While the station lacks some amenities such as waiting rooms, accessible toilets, and seated areas, you'll find available customer help points and CCTV coverage for added security.
When it comes to getting around, Pokesdown Station is well-linked with local bus services. For those in need of bustling transport options, the station provides convenience through its proximity to bus routes for Bournemouth and Christchurch, located on Christchurch Road (A35). Unfortunately, the station does not currently offer cycle hire facilities or an easy set-down point for those with impaired mobility, but it does have bicycle racks with space for up to 8 bikes, including CCTV monitoring.

Acton Main Line is equipped with the essentials to ensure a seamless travel experience. For starters, purchasing and collecting tickets is hassle-free with a ticket office operational during peak morning hours each weekday, and extended hours on Saturdays. Moreover, ticket machines are available around the clock, including those that are accessible for passengers with mobility challenges.
Accessibility remains a priority, with step-free access to all platforms, ensuring ease of movement for wheelchair users and those who might require assistance. The station is categorized as Accessibility Category A, affirming its helpful amenities for people with disabilities. Staff is always at hand to lend a hand using ramps for train access when necessary.
Information is readily available at help points and ticket offices, with clear customer service provisions accessible via phone for further assistance. While CCTV assures safety, the station does not store luggage or provide traditional waiting rooms. However, there are multiple seating options, including sheltered areas on Platforms 3 and 4 offering a bit of respite during your journey.
When it comes to refreshment facilities, ATMs, or shops, Acton Main Line is a bit modest. While this may be a drawback for some, it maintains the station's quaint charm and motivates travelers to enjoy what's nearby.
When it comes to travel connections, Acton Main Line does not operate rail replacement bus services. However, Transport for London buses are readily available just outside the station, ensuring you can continue your journey throughout the city with ease. Perhaps you're flying out or arriving from Heathrow — worry not, as the Elizabeth Line provides efficient service to the airport directly from this station, smoothing out the travel process.
